The traditional barrier to high-level lighting design has always been the complexity of the tools. In the past, running a full simulation required specialized hardware and hours of processing time. By moving the 3D lighting calculation process into a browser-based environment, that barrier disappears. A designer can now sit in a client meeting, open a laptop, and instantly demonstrate how a shift in layout affects the entire atmosphere of a room. This accessibility allows the technical side of design to become a fluid, interactive part of the "Playground" phase, where ideas can be tested, broken, and perfected in real-time without ever leaving the creative flow.
At the heart of this evolution is the ability to move beyond guesswork. Tools like a lux calculator and a beam angle simulator provide a scientific baseline for beauty. It is one thing to promise a client that a space will be "bright enough," but it is quite another to provide project documentation that proves every task surface meets international standards for visual comfort. By using interactive render photos that utilize real-world IES files, designers can see exactly how light will graze a specific stone texture or bounce off apolished floor. This eliminates the "dark corner" surprises that often plague projects after installation, ensuring that the final result is as functional as it is aesthetic.
